APPROVAL OF DISTRICT EXPENSES
3.
Summary: Local District expenses represent costs that are the sole responsibility of the individual
District. Allocated expenses, which are generally distributed twice per year in conjunction with the
receipt of the District’s service charge revenue, represent the District’s proportionate share of expenses
made by the Joint Outfall System pursuant to the Joint Outfall Agreement. The Agreement provides for
the joint administration, technical support and management of the operations, maintenance, and capital
costs associated with all the shared facilities for all of the signatory Districts, along with the
methodology for determining the proportionate costs for each District. A variety of financial reports
providing additional context, including payment registers and previously approved budgets, are available
on the Districts’ website at lacsd.org/financial-documents. This item is consistent with the Districts’
Guiding Principle of commitment to fiscal responsibility and prudent financial stewardship.
